This paper aims to deal with the aspects of postmodern-feminism through the analysis of postmodern feminism and The French Lieutenant's Woman In the second half of the 20th century, the old phenomena in the world culture are intermingled with new. And we call this periodic change as postmodernism. This kind of change has affected the previous, traditional feminism(for example, radical feminism, liberal feminism, Marxist feminism, etc), and feminism has been changing with postmodern consciousness.
In this paper, this kind of changed feminism will be called as postmodern-feminism, and this term includes the new French feminism, eco-feminism, postfeminism, and postmodern feminism. Though postmodern feminism has many kinds of diversities, this paper focalizes on two aspects, namely, the "acceptability of 'Other'" and "the use of feminity (especially that of sexuality)".
John Fowles's The French Lieutenant's Woman(1969) is famous for a typical postmodern novel, so this paper examines this novel with a little different viewpoint. First of all, this paper chooses the second ending as a proper ending from three endings which Fowles suggests in this novel. In the second ending of chapter 60, Sarah and Charles get married and make a happy and beautiful family with their daughter who was born from their sexual love of only one time.
Sarah is typical Other, but she accepts her position as Other and uses this for herself advantageously. This is different from the previous feminism. Previous feminism didn't agree with women's Other, and they struggled, not to be Other. The meaning of the term 'Other' is 'not subject' here.
Secondly, Sarah uses her feminity, especially her sexuality to get the true love from Charles, and finally she achieves the goal. Using feminity or sexuality as a weapon was a kind of taboo in Victorian period and in previous feminism. But in postmodern feminism, feminity and sexuality are natural just as 'the Earth as Mother.' Therefore, Sarah's behavior of using sexuality is very natural, and this is the basis of life.
Postmodern-feminism has many different aspects, too, because the postmodern characteristics are diverse. So, this paper deals only with very small area of postmodern-feminism. This paper is expected to help to understand the postmodern-feminism and our changing society.
